
In the article various theoretical approaches in studying risk behavior are discussed, and also the attempt to consider the phenomenon of risk according to the general theory of the functional systems of academician P. K. Anokhin is made. The theoretical statements proving the possible addictive nature of the activity associated with risk are given. It is supposed that the readiness for the risk represents a particular specific motivational condition which, under the terms of uncertainty, is integrated into a functional system. The risk is considered as the independent component of the system organization of an individual purposeful behavior.
В статье обсуждаются различные теоретические подходы в изучении рискового поведения, а также предпринимается попытка рассмотреть феномен риска с позиций общей теории функциональных систем академика П.К. Анохина. Приведены теоретические положения, доказывающие возможную аддиктивную природу активности, связанной с риском. Предполагается, что готовность к риску представляет собой особое специфическое мотивационное состояние, в условиях неопределенности интегрированное в функциональную систему. Риск рассматривается как самостоятельный компонент системной организации целенаправленного поведения субъекта.
